Understanding the Mechanics of Crash Gameplay
At its heart, the crash game’s mechanic is surprisingly straightforward. A round begins with a starting multiplier of 1x. This multiplier then begins to climb, often visually represented by a steadily accelerating curve. Players place a bet at the beginning of each round, and their potential winnings increase in direct proportion to the multiplier. However, this upward trajectory doesn’t last forever. At a random point, the multiplier 'crashes', and any players who haven’t previously cashed out lose their wager. The critical skill lies in predicting when the crash will occur – or, more accurately, in determining a risk-tolerance level and cashing out before the inevitable happens. The Martingale and Anti-Martingale Systems
Two commonly discussed betting systems are the Martingale and Anti-Martingale. The Martingale system involves doubling your bet after each loss, with the aim of recovering all previous losses and securing a small profit when you eventually win. While seemingly effective in theory, it requires a substantial bankroll and carries the risk of hitting betting limits or experiencing a prolonged losing streak. The Anti-Martingale system, conversely, involves increasing your bet after each win and decreasing it after each loss. This strategy capitalizes on winning streaks and minimizes losses during losing streaks, but it’s less effective at recovering significant losses. Both systems should be approached with caution and a thorough understanding of their associated risks. Responsible bankroll management is critical when implementing either strategy.

How Provably Fair Systems Work
The core principle behind a provably fair system is that the outcome of a game round is determined before the round even begins, but the result remains hidden until the round is complete. This is achieved through a combination of server seeds (created by the game operator) and client seeds (provided by the player). A hashing algorithm combines these seeds to generate a random number, which determines the crash point. Players can then use the publicly available server seed and their own client seed to independently verify the generated number and confirm that the game outcome was indeed random and unbiased. Different platforms may use slightly different algorithms, but the underlying principle of transparency and verifiability remains constant. A commitment from the platform to openly display these seeds is a strong indication of its commitment to fair play.

Psychological Aspects of Crash Gaming
Beyond the mathematical and strategic elements, crash games tap into fundamental psychological principles. The anticipation of a large payout, combined with the fear of losing one's stake, creates a potent emotional cocktail. The rising multiplier triggers a dopamine rush, encouraging players to hold on longer, even when a rational assessment suggests cashing out. This can lead to "chasing losses", where players increase their bets in an attempt to recoup previous losses, often resulting in even greater financial setbacks. The intermittent reinforcement – the unpredictable nature of the crash – further reinforces this behavior. It’s crucial to be aware of these psychological biases and approach the game with a calm, rational mindset.
Avoiding emotional decision-making is paramount. Establishing pre-defined cash-out targets and sticking to them, regardless of the multiplier's height, can help mitigate the risk of impulsive behavior. Taking regular breaks and avoiding playing under the influence of alcohol or other substances are also essential for maintaining a clear and objective perspective.
